Eve Karasik Joins the Firm

Prominent Bankruptcy Lawyer Eve H. Karasik Has Joined Top Los Angeles Firm of Levene, Neale, Bender, Yoo & Brill as a Partner

April 2015 Los Angeles

Eve H. Karasik, a prominent bankruptcy and business restructuring attorney, has joined Levene, Neale, Bender, Yoo & Brill L.L.P., as a partner at one of the Los Angeles region’s leading firms specializing in bankruptcy, business reorganizations and commercial litigation. Her appointment was effective immediately.

Before joining LNBYB, Ms. Karasik was a shareholder in the bankruptcy group at Gordon Silver, a multi-practice firm, and managing shareholder at its firm’s Los Angeles office. She was named the 2015 Bankruptcy Attorney of the Year by the Century City Bar Association.

“We are very fortunate to have an attorney with Eve Karasik’s impeccable credentials and experience join our firm, and are excited about what we expect to be her significant contribution to the continued success of LNBYB,” said David L. Neale, co-managing partner of Levene, Neale, Bender, Yoo & Brill.

Ms. Karasik was also a senior shareholder at Stutman, Treister & Glatt, another one-time leading Los Angeles area bankruptcy law firm. One of her colleagues there was Gary Klausner, who joined Levene Neale in May 2014 as a senior partner.

“The addition of a prominent attorney like Eve Karasik to our staff of highly experienced and creative attorneys enhances our firm’s ability to achieve successful resolution of our clients’ complex financial challenges,” added Ron Bender, co-managing partner.

At Levene Neale, Ms. Karasik will continue to focus on corporate restructuring and bankruptcy, including the representation of Chapter 11 debtors, unsecured creditor and equity committees, trustees, secured and unsecured creditors, and parties involved in bankruptcy litigation
and appeals.

Since its founding in 1995, LNBYB has forged a strong presence in the Los Angeles legal community, known for expediting the resolution of complex issues for a diversity of prominent companies. The firm is considered a leader in the rescue and rehabilitation of financially distressed businesses and corporations.

Ms. Karasik is a board member of the American Bankruptcy Institute and the Los Angeles Bankruptcy Forum. She is also a member of the International Women’s Insolvency and Restructuring Confederation and Women’s Lawyers Association of Los Angeles. She was admitted to the California Bar in 1991, after earning her J.D. at University of Southern California Gould School of Law, Order of the Coif.
